CVE-2022-29153

HashiCorp Consul and Consul Enterprise up to 1.9.16, 1.10.9, and 1.11.4 may allow server side request forgery when the Consul client agent follows redirects returned by HTTP health check endpoints. Fixed in 1.9.17, 1.10.10, and 1.11.5...

Consul’s HTTP Health Check May Allow Server Side Request Forgery

Summary A vulnerability was identified in Consul and Consul Enterprise “Consul” such that HTTP health check endpoints returning an HTTP redirect may be abused as a vector for server-side request forgery SSRF. This vulnerability, CVE-2022-29153, was fixed in Consul 1.9.17, 1.10.10, and 1.11.5...
